Gundersen Health System, based in La Crosse, WI, is a leading provider of primary and specialized care across western Wisconsin, southeast Minnesota, and northeast Iowa, serving over 500,000 residents in 22 counties. This physician-led, not-for-profit healthcare system includes a 325-bed teaching hospital, tertiary referral center, Level II Trauma Center, community clinics, 6 affiliate critical access hospitals, nursing homes, behavioral health services, vision centers, pharmacies, and air and ground ambulance services.
